Output e81e1dde4a308b515b5d59b5643f11f4efc59b61958c8fa0e7fe0d838c1c6e39:67

value
74681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42a568d5bba4fd82e4a14b0714a3f9da08f95bd5 OP_EQUALVERIFY OP_CHECKSIG
address
175PkWsvKfUajhC9wDicH9bDfMEBxm7Vt4
transaction
e81e1dde4a308b515b5d59b5643f11f4efc59b61958c8fa0e7fe0d838c1c6e39
confirmations
226700
spent
true